This service reminds of the German company Deutsche Bahn. They actually were one of the pioneers of the rent a bike system but gained a competitive advantage thru their dedicated call center with helped route bikers to rent/lock station, set up new accounts and provided a 24 hour service. They were actually profiled as the innovator for rent anywhere. Best part about this service is it works with local transportation bus or rail, and puts their bikes in key spots. Most of the pricing seems similar.

also quite cool is the swiss project called: mobility
http://www.mobility.ch
there it is all about car sharing. you have a member card and on every train station in switzerland you'll find a few cards you can reserver in advance. we see in switzerland that more and more people dont have a car but use public transport and if they need a car, they'll combine it with the mobility program. plus: in all the big cities you have tons of those cars. and its heavily supported by swiss government and therefore cheap.
mobility seems exactly like ZipCar which seems to have really gotten popular in american cities as well.
